Adaptive Cruise Control Design Using Reach Control
2018 21st International Conference on Intelligent Transportation Systems (ITSC), 2018We investigate a correct-by-construction synthesis of piecewise affine feedback controllers designed to satisfy the strict safety specifications set forth by the adaptive cruise control (ACC) problem. Our design methodology is based on the formulation of the ACC problem as a reach control problem on a polytope in a 2D state space.

Adaptive Cruise Control System using Balance-Based Adaptive Control technique
2012 17th International Conference on Methods & Models in Automation & Robotics (MMAR), 2012In this paper, a nonlinear Balance-Based Adaptive Control (B-BAC) technique is proposed for the design of an Adaptive Cruise Control (ACC) System. The architecture for ACC system represents the cascade control and it includes two control loops. Supervised adaptive dynamic programming based adaptive cruise control
2011 IEEE Symposium on Adaptive Dynamic Programming and Reinforcement Learning (ADPRL), 2011This paper proposes a supervised adaptive dynamic programming (SADP) algorithm for the full range Adaptive cruise control (ACC) system. The full range ACC system considers both the ACC situation in highway system and the stop and go (SG) situation in urban street way system.
